如何让ghc调用链接器与其默认配置不同?

时间:2019-03-09 02:32:21

标签: haskell linker ghc

我可以将cc-Wl选项一起使用,将选项传递给链接器。例如:

cc -Wl,-rpath -Wl,/usr/local/lib

这将使用-rpath /usr/local/lib

调用链接器

如何用ghc进行同样的操作?

我还如何指示ghc使用与其默认链接器不同的链接器?例如,如果将ghc配置为使用/usr/bin/ld,我如何告诉它使用/usr/local/bin/ld?用cc做到这一点的一种方法是:

cc -B/usr/local/bin

1 个答案:

答案 0 :(得分:0)

我认为您可以做到ghc -optl-rpath -optl/usr/local/libghc -optc-B/usr/local/bin